in December of 2020 I hopped onto Twitter to find that Mark Rober wanted to do a video together sounds good I said how hard could it be couldn't be that hard right if you haven't seen Mark's video yet you should start there this video is a technical Deep dive that will make a lot more sense if you have some context specifically we're going to talk about some of the really nerdy design choices we made on that first vehicle that attempted these egg drops this is the vehicle with the movable fins at the back that we tried to do lots of fancy guidance and control stuff on Mark wanted to do the world's highest egg drop and the idea was that we'd bring the egg up to a hundred thousand feet drop it and then recover the egg like a normal egg drop but just with a lot more feet in between the drop point and the landing point if you're familiar with Mark rubber you know what an egg drop is but the goal is to recover the egg safely on the ground without it cracking Landing the egg safely has a couple of factors so let's start from the ground up the first is The Landing Pad we calculated the eggs terminal velocity on its own to be about 30 to 35 meters per second which is a sporty 75 miles per hour our first idea with this project was to take a minor shortcut and have a 10 by 10 tiled mattress on the ground or tiled foam pads these foam pads were designed to soften the blow of the egg hitting them and Mark was able to validate that the egg could withstand hitting them at its terminal velocity so then the second question about Landing the egg safely is how do you get it over that mattress how do you get it over that Landing Pad this one question has been on my mind for the last two years so let's go way back and work out how to do this first we need to know where the egg is going to be at 100 000 feet and what the error margin is on that to find this we used a weather balloon simulation tool and calculated the regular dispersion of a balloon launched up to a hundred thousand feet over about a two hour flight time we calculated these dispersions on a flight over the Bonneville Salt Flats from zero to a hundred thousand feet and from what we could tell the expected diversion was within about a kilometer of range so let's say we let the balloon pass over that Landing Pad somewhere in that one kilometer Corridor now we have to separate the egg and still guide it a little bit back to the pad in order to stay true to the idea of what an egg drop should be we wanted to keep the egg in free...
